C. Corvi is a scholar working on Food Science, Spectroscopy and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. According to data from OpenAlex, C. Corvi has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 650 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Food Science, 5 papers in Spectroscopy and 3 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is. Recurrent topics in C. Corvi’s work include Pesticide Residue Analysis and Safety (5 papers), Heavy metals in environment (3 papers) and Analytical chemistry methods development (3 papers). C. Corvi is often cited by papers focused on Pesticide Residue Analysis and Safety (5 papers), Heavy metals in environment (3 papers) and Analytical chemistry methods development (3 papers). C. Corvi coll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, France and Canada. C. Corvi's co-authors include Patrick Edder, Didier Ortelli, Ernst A. H. Friedheim, Umberto Piantini, Sérgio Lima Santiago, R. L. Thomas, J. Tarradellas, Jean-Pierre Vernet, Jean‐Luc Loizeau and D.J. Gregor and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Chromatography A, Analytica Chimica Acta and Hydrological Processes.
